Global Epo Biomarkers Market size was valued at USD 3.2 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 3.41 Billion in 2025 to USD 5.74 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 6.7% during the forecast period (2026-2033).
The global EPO biomarkers market is significantly driven by the increasing prevalence of chronic kidney disease and the need for precise anemia management, resulting in a heightened demand for erythropoietin and biomarker testing. This market encompasses diagnostic assays and analytical platforms that quantify key biomarkers like EPO, hepcidin, and soluble transferrin receptor, supporting anemia etiology determination and monitoring of therapy. The transition from single-analyte immunoassays to sophisticated mass spectrometry and multiplex formats has revolutionized the sector. Regulatory acceptance of hepcidin and related markers enhances market dynamics, encouraging hospitals to invest in multiplex platforms that lower testing costs and facilitate broader screening initiatives. Moreover, AI advancements improve diagnostic accuracy through enhanced signal detection and interpretation, leading to more consistent, actionable results in clinical settings.

Global Epo Biomarkers Market Segments Analysis
Global epo biomarkers market is segmented by product type, biomarker type, application, end-user, distribution channel and region. Based on product type, the market is segmented into EPO Blood Test Kits, EPO ELISA Assays, EPO Rapid Test Strips and Other Assay Formats. Based on biomarker type, the market is segmented into Erythropoietin (EPO), Related Biomarkers and Multi-analyte Panels. Based on application, the market is segmented into Clinical Diagnostics, Sports Performance & Doping Control, Research & Drug Development, Personalized Medicine and Others. Based on end-user, the market is segmented into Hospitals & Diagnostic Labs, Clinical Research Organizations, Academic & Research Institutes, Biotechnology & Pharma Companies and Sports & Anti-Doping Agencies. Based on distribution channel, the market is segmented into Direct OEM Sales, Distributors & Dealers and Online Sales. Based on region, the market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America and Middle East & Africa.

Restraints in the Global Epo Biomarkers Market
The high costs associated with advanced EPO biomarker assays and the necessary instrumentation present a significant challenge for the Global EPO Biomarkers market. This financial burden limits access in resource-constrained healthcare environments, discouraging many laboratories from routinely adopting these advanced tests. Budget constraints often lead procurement teams to favor more affordable options, postponing investment in specialized platforms, while reimbursement scrutiny from payers can hinder the adoption of newer assays. Additionally, the ongoing expenses related to training and maintenance contribute to the overall ownership costs, making smaller clinical laboratories reluctant to embrace extensive biomarker testing, thereby impeding market growth and the widespread use of innovative EPO diagnostics.
